Conclusion Steve Burns’s Songs for Dustmites is more than a curiosity—it is a carefully crafted indie-pop record that reconciles playful origins with thoughtful adulthood. Through tasteful arrangements, sincere lyrics, and committed performances, Burns delivered an album that stands on its own musical merits and invites reappraisal beyond the novelty of his public persona.
